Star Worlds 2008 - Online registration now open

by Connie Bischoff on 5 Dec 2007
Star Worlds 2007, Cascais, Portugal Fried Elliott http://www.friedbits.com

When over 200 Star sailors arrive at Miami’s Coral Reef Yacht Club next April to sail in the Star Worlds 2008, they had better be ready for the fierce battle to win the Worlds in this oldest of the Olympic sailing classes.

There are still four slots open for nations to compete in the Olympics with six to eight nations trying to qualify. Germany and other nations will be using it as their Olympic trials. It may even more exciting than the recent U.S. Olympic Star Trials where, before the last race, the top three teams were only separated by five points.

The SW’08 has great sponsor support from the marine industry with SLAM (Official Technical Clothing Sponsor), Sperry Top-Sider (Official Shoe Sponsor), Harken (Official Technical Equipment and Gear Sponsor), North Sails and Quantum Sails. The beer sponsor is Heineken. Did you ever notice the Star on their logo?

The Star World Championship 2008 (SW’08) www.starworlds2008.com is up and running and registration is open.

The SW’08 Committee had six goals for the website: information prior to the regatta with a huge FAQs section, great regatta photos by Fried Elliot, immediate news articles, an online store and on-line registration.

Once the sailing begins, the website will have a live-update from the water which will show the status of each race (i.e., mark roundings, wind delays, etc.). Once the races are over, there will be immediate online results.
